As Performance Marketing, you'll work hands-on with campaign creation, ad production, testing, optimization, and performance analysis across multiple channels, audiences, and markets.
You'll work primarily in Meta Ads Manager, Google Ads, LinkedIn Campaign Manager, GA4, and related performance marketing tools.
Create, launch, manage, and optimize advertising campaigns across paid channels
Develop ad copy, campaign messaging, creative concepts, and campaign assets for different audiences and customer segments
Create, adapt, and publish ads across Meta, Google, LinkedIn, and other relevant platforms
Test different creative concepts, visual approaches, messaging, hooks, offers, and audience strategies to improve performance
Analyze campaign performance and turn insights into clear actions
Build and improve automated marketing flows and customer journeys
Run structured experiments and continuously improve campaign effectiveness
Collaborate with internal teams across Creators, Studio, and Cinema
Help ensure marketing investments generate measurable business results
Unlike many performance marketing roles that focus primarily on reporting and optimization, this role also involves creating and developing advertising concepts, ad copy, campaign messaging, creative variations, and campaign assets. You'll be actively involved in both the creative and performance side of digital marketing.
A key part of the role is continuously testing new creative concepts, formats, messaging, audiences, and campaign structures to identify what drives the strongest business outcomes.
You will be responsible for continuously improving key performance metrics such as ROAS, CPA, conversion rate, customer acquisition, and revenue contribution.
